Choosing the best road bike for your requirements is not as straight forward as it once was, thanks to huge advancements in material, design and manufacturing processes. Road bikes have now branched out into many different categories and specialities, from featherweight climbers and supersonic racers, to mile-munching endurance machines and everything in between.
